Jabrin (Arabic: جبرين), also spelled Jabreen, Jabrin, and Jibreen, is a small town in Ad Dakhiliyah Governorate in northeastern Oman near Nizwa and the Jabal Akhdar Mountains.
The town is known for its large castle, which was built by the Yaruba dynasty Imam Bil'arab bin Sultan, who ruled from 1679 to 16921 and who was buried on site. The castle is open to visitors.2
